diff options
Diffstat (limited to 'bin')
-rwxr-xr-x | bin/ldap2bind |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/bin/ldap2bind b/bin/ldap2bind index 139a4b0..c055921 100755 --- a/bin/ldap2bind +++ b/bin/ldap2bind @@ -180,6 +180,16 @@ magicItems.each { |m| setAs(vhostalias, m['tnHost'], m['dn'][0]) } end + property = {} + if m['tnWebVHostProperties'] + m['tnWebVHostProperties'].each{ |prop| + (key, val) = prop.split('=', 2) + property[key] = val + } + end + unless property['stats'] == "no" + setAs("stats." + m['tnWebVHostServerName'], m['tnHost'], m['dn'][0]) + end when 'tnDNSrr' if m['tnDNSaRecord'] setAsDirect(m['tnDNSdomainname'], m['tnDNSaRecord'], m['dn'][0]) |